Plastic pyramids can be divided into two main groups: transparent and opaque. Currently available on the market are six different opaque colors. Opaque pyramids can yield substantive differences in games, as the large and medium sizes can conceal information in the form of small and/or medium pyramids. For those who would like to design a game with these characteristics, it may be useful to know that two small pyramids can stack and fit perfectly under one large pyramid.
Pyramid | Color | Year First Introduced | Color Scheme |
---|---|---|---|
White | 2003? | Xeno | |
Silver | 2016 | N/A | |
Martian Red | 2016 | N/A | |
Kickstarter Green | 2016 | N/A | |
Gray | 2024 | N/A | |
Black | 2000 | Rainbow |
